Elsey, Missouri
Unincorporated community in the American state of Missouri
Elsey is an unincorporated community in Stone County, Missouri, United States.[1] It is located at the intersection of State Routes 173 and 413 and is halfway between Galena and Crane. The community is part of the Branson, Missouri Micropolitan Statistical Area.
A post office called Elsey was established in 1900, and remained in operation until 1957.[2] "Elsey" was a name assigned by postal officials.[3]
